



Despite their namesake, queerpunk darlings Pretty Pretty Awful often find themselves being told they're anything but. The band's sound offers a blend of garage rock buzz and old school punk sensabilities along with a distinctive lyrical flair that sets them apart. From shredding to sold out crowds alongside performance artists & drag kings/queens to playing Cleveland landmark events like Ingenuity Fest & Brite Winter, Pretty Pretty Awful has made a name for themselves by their unique style & emotionally charged performances.
Pretty Pretty Awful is... AP (vocals/rhythm guitar), Donnie (drums), JV (vocals, lead guitar), Roxie (bass), Weiland (backing vocals, percussion) & Chayla (backing vocals, keys, theremin)
Get Mean, the long awaited debut EP from Cleveland queer punks, Pretty Pretty Awful, comes tearing into the world like a snarling b-movie monster finally bursting out of the closet. Featuring 5 of the band's catchiest rippers, GET MEAN is the perfect introduction to PPA who meld a unique blend of garage-rock edge with pop-punk bop featuring songs about loves lost, selves found, and the gutters we all so often haunt.
